Revd Jim Percival and his daughter Ruth were originally arrested by police in 2014 on suspicion and conspiracy to conceal the birth of a child, after police found the body of a baby boy at their home in Freckleton, Lancashire.
After investigating police took no further action regarding those offences and released the pair.
It is still not clear how the baby died.
Mr Percival, formerly of Holy Trinity Church Freckleton (above), and his daughter were then arrested again last Thursday.
In a statement, a police spokesman said: "They were interviewed at a police station in the county during the course of Thursday and have been released on bail until February 16 pending further enquiries.
"Both the man and the woman had been previously arrested on suspicion of murder and conspiracy to conceal the birth of a child. Both have now been released no further action in respect of those offences.
"Police were called to an address in Freckleton at shortly before 6pm on Tuesday, November 25 2014 following an initial report that a woman had given birth to a still-born baby.
"An investigation has been launched and a post mortem examination has been carried out."
